LAHORE,(APP):The number of coronavirus patients has reached 37,090
in Punjab after the registration of 1782 new cases during
the last 24 hours.
Punjab Primary and Secondary Healthcare department
spokesman said on Sunday noon that 24 more patients
lost their lives and now the death toll has reached to 683
in the province, however, 8109 coronavirus patients
recovered.
The health department confirmed that 691 new cases of
COVID-19 were registered in Lahore, 7 in Nankana Sahib
district, 19 in Kasur, 13 in Sheikhupura, 143 in Rawalpindi,
1 in Jehlum, 5 in Attock, 1 in Chakwal, 58 in Gujranwala,
31 in Sialkot, 84 in Gujrat,  6 in Hafizabad, 2 in Mandi Bahauddin,
111 in Multan, 5 in Khanewal, 16 in Vehari, 291 in Faisalabad,
2 in Chiniot, 6 in Toba Tek Singh, 4 in Jhang, 15 in Rahimyar
Khan, 4 in Sargodha, 4 in Mianwali, 1 in Khoshab, 10 in Bahawalnagar,
37 Bahawalpur, 133 in Dera Ghazi Khan, 41 in Muzaffargarh,
12 in Layyah, 6 in Sahiwal,10 in Okara and 6 new cases of
COVID-19 were reported in Pakpattan district during the last
24 hours. 
The Punjab health department so far conducted 282,807
coronavirus tests in the province.
